Clinical Applications Specialist - Anesthesia & Respiratory Care

Job Description

Summary The Clinical Applications Specialist (CAS) delivers Patient Care Solutions (PCS) clinical and operational expertise by providing excellent education and training support for the anesthesia and monitoring product portfolio to clinical end-users. These clinical experts will facilitate evidence-based practice and support the customer experience and commercial teams from pre-sale through post implementation by providing effective outcome-based education and training solutions. This role requires residence within Minneapolis/St. Paul or up to 1hr from those main cities.

Job Description

Essential Responsibilities

  • Develop product, clinical, and software knowledge, skills, and competence within a specific PCS modality.
  • Correlates theoretical knowledge with clinical and product information to provide clinicians with the knowledge and the skills to obtain optimal performance from their GE HealthCare equipment.
  • Provides pre-sale product clinical evaluations and/or educational sessions to potential customers.
  • In partnership with customers, develop and administer clinical training to the end-user personnel aligned with sales order agreement (SOA) to deliver excellent clinical education to achieve high Net Promotor Scores (NPS).
  • Collaborate and coordinate the delivery of customer training with a targeted integrated account management approach including sales, project management, and other service organization teams in accordance with the SOA/terms and conditions.
  • Drive realization of revenue thru execution of on-site or remote clinical education delivery.
  • Produce comprehensive, consistent, and timely completion of documentation requirements pre-through post training.
  • Provide ongoing post-installation training and support as needed. Support existing customers with additional training as needed or as product enhancements are launched that require additional training or implementation.
  • Maintain customer relationships and communicate all relevant product and/or customer concerns or opportunities to the PCS Management team, Field Sales, Marketing, Customer Loyalty Leads, and Technical Support regarding technical and clinical issue or how to improve the quality of the product or overall product offerings.
  • Manage travel & lodging (T&L) budget to plan through optimization of travel strategies and cost savings. Submits expense reports within guidelines and provides and maintains clear and complete records to comply with all elements relevant to the position.
  • Possess strong, interpersonal & customer skills and places personal & business integrity at forefront.
  • Differentiate with exceptional customer service and actively integrate user experience and outcomes.

Required Qualifications

  • Holds an active Registered Respiratory Therapist license with 3-5 years of ICU experience.
  • Ability/willingness to travel extensively 80+% (4-5 days per week including some weekends) within US and Canada (USCAN) via multiple modes of transportation (car, air travel, train, etc.) as necessary.
  • Maintain a valid driver’s license and satisfactory driving record.
  • Proficient use of software applications, such as Windows Outlook, Word, PowerPoint, and Excel and navigating other computer and web-based tools (intranet/internet/apps).
  • Ability to learn specialized industry specific software and provide digital education and training solutions.
  • Must comply with vendor credentialing requirements. Ability to meet customer site access requirements, including COVID-19 vaccination.
  • Will be required to register with one or more vendor credentialing services by various customer hospitals. This requires, but not limited to, proof of immunization for, mumps, measles, and rubella (MMR) and hepatitis and drug testing /screening.
  • Candidate must be willing to work out of an office or home/remote office.
  • residence within Minneapolis/St Paul or up to 1hr from those main cities.

For U.S. based positions only, the pay range for this position is $92,000.00-$138,000.00 Annual. It is not typical for an individual to be hired at or near the top of the pay range and compensation decisions are dependent on the facts and circumstances of each case. The specific compensation offered to a candidate may be influenced by a variety of factors including skills, qualifications, experience and location. In addition, this position may also be eligible to earn performance based incentive compensation, which may include cash bonus(es) and/or long term incentives (LTI). GE HealthCare offers a competitive benefits package, including not but limited to medical, dental, vision, paid time off, a 401(k) plan with employee and company contribution opportunities, life, disability, and accident insurance, and tuition reimbursement.
